Demystifying Limits, Derivatives, and Integrals

Diving into the realms of calculus can often feel like navigating a labyrinth. ideas such as limits, derivatives, and integrals regularly appear to be shrouded in mystery, leaving many students feeling bewildered. However, with a clear understanding of their fundamental definitions and applications, these powerful tools become accessible.

  • Limits provide a framework for studying the behavior of functions as they approach specific points.
  • Derivatives unveil the immediate rate of change of a function at any given point, shedding light on its gradient.
  • Integrals, on the other hand, allow us to calculate areas under curves and accumulate quantities over intervals.

By understanding these core principles, we can unlock the potential of calculus to address a wide range of problems in engineering and beyond.

Calculus 1 Explained Simply

Calculus 1 is the core branch of mathematics that deals with continuous variation. It introduces the concepts of functions and areas under curves, providing tools to model dynamic phenomena.

One of the key ideas in Calculus 1 is the derivative, which measures how a function's value changes with respect to its variable. Derivatives have wide-ranging implications in fields like physics, engineering, and economics.

Another important concept is the integral, which represents the accumulation of a quantity over a given interval. Integrals are essential for calculating things like work, displacement, and volume.

Through its rigorous language and versatile tools, Calculus 1 opens the door to a deeper understanding of the concepts of change.
